Bullets whistled through the rude window casing and spattered on the heavy door, and one split the clay between the logs before Jean, narrowly missing him.

Another volley followed, then another.

The rustlers had repeating rifles and they were emptying their magazines.

Jean changed his position.

The other men profited by his wise move.
